A New Leaf Publications (ANLP) is the publishing department of MA. A New Leaf Publications oversees and administers the publication, distribution, and business of MA literature and publications for the purpose of carrying the message of recovery and service to the society of Marijuana Anonymous and to entities outside of MA.
- Responsible for the literature after its creation, facilitating the process of getting the MA literature into the hands of members and the addict who is still suffering.
- Formats all MA Literature including pamphlets for their publication
- Oversees the distribution of Life with Hope, the MA Workbook, and Living Every Day with Hope
- Produces the monthly literary publication A New Leaf

ANLP Design Editor
(former title: Publishing Editor) [Volunteer, appointed by ANLP Department]
Job Requirements
- Work collaboratively with the other two Editors, the Content Editor (volunteer) and the Creative Designer (Special Worker) to prepare each month’s issue of A New Leaf, MA’s monthly creative publication, and following the ANLP Department’s Publication Schedule.
- The Design Editor is responsible for formatting each month’s issue of A New Leaf by populating elected content into existing templates and using documented processes for scheduling each issue using MailChimp
- Populate content into MailChimp templates to format and schedule batches of “Daily Dose” emails with each day’s entry from MA’s book of daily reflections, Living Every Day with Hope; working with the Creative Designer
- Maintain regular communication with the other Editors (Content Editor and Creative Designer) and the ANLP Chair
- Attend all required ANLP meetings, and communicate with the ANLP Chair in advance if you cannot attend any required ANLP meetings, or will either be late or need to leave early. Due to the collaborative nature of ANLP, it is necessary for all Department members to work together in regularly scheduled meetings. Specifically, it is expected that the Design Editor attend:
- ANLP Monthly Department Meeting: Held every 2nd Sunday of each month at 9 am PT / 12 pm ET / 4pm UTC (approximately 2-3 hrs); All Department members are expected to attend, report on the month’s activities, and actively participate in each month’s ANLP Department meeting;
- ANLP Steering Committee Meetings: Held every 2nd & 4th Thursday of each month from 5-6 pm PT / 8-9 pm ET / 12-1 am UTC. It is highly suggested that all Department members attend each of the 2 one-hour long ANLP Steering Committee meetings for general ANLP strategy discussions.
- All ANL Editors are required to attend the 1st of two monthly hour-long ANLP Steering Committee meetings (on the 2nd Thursday of each month) to finalize each issue of A New Leaf before the 13th, including the letter from the Department.
- All Department members are highly suggested, but not required to attend the 2nd monthly ANLP Steering Committee Meeting, (on the 4th Thursday of each month) a “working session” for writing sales copy, discussing ANLP strategy, revising the Best Practices and job descriptions, preparing flyers and announcements, revising website content and publication-related discussions.
- Quarterly Editor Meetings: All A New Leaf Editors (the Design Editor, Content Editor, and Creative Designer) are expected to meet at least once each quarter with the ANLP Chair to plan each quarter’s issues.
